Futures dip as focus shifts to inflation data for clues on Fed's rate path

(Reuters) -U.S. stock index futures edged lower on Wednesday as Treasury yields moved higher and weighed on rate-sensitive equities ahead of crucial inflation data that will offer more clarity on the pace of the Federal Reserve's interest rate reductions. All three major Wall Street indexes closed lower on Tuesday, as a strong rally following the U.S. election lost some steam, while the benchmark U.S. 10-year Treasury yield moved above the 4.4% level on expectations that President-elect Donald Trump's policies could exacerbate inflation.

Investors expect more growth and inflation after Trump win, BofA survey shows

Global investors changed their expectations on the global economy in the wake of Donald Trump's election win, and now see higher growth than they did before, as well as higher inflation, according to Bank of America's monthly fund manager survey. BofA polled 179 participants with $503 billion assets under management. Of those, 22% responded after the U.S. election, won by Republican former president Trump.

Trump's economic agenda for his second term is clouding the outlook for mortgage rates

Donald Trump’s election win is clouding the outlook for mortgage rates even before he gets back to the White House. The president-elect campaigned on a promise to make homeownership more affordable by lowering mortgage rates through policies aimed at knocking out inflation. Mortgage rates are influenced by several factors, including moves in the yield for U.S. 10-year Treasury bonds, which lenders use as a guide to price home loans.

Trump win could be a double whammy for Hungary's economy

Donald Trump's victory may be a political boon for Hungarian leader Viktor Orban but on the economy, Trump is bad news for Hungary - adding to inflationary risks due to a weak forint and lower output due to possible tariffs on Europe's auto sector. With the forint already on the back foot since the Hungarian central bank's latest rate cut in September, Trump's stunning win sent central Europe's worst-performing currency to levels last seen in 2022, when the bank launched emergency rate hikes.

US inflation may have picked up in October after months of easing

Annual inflation may have risen in October for the first time in seven months, a sign that price increases might be leveling off after steadily cooling for more than two years. Measured month to month, prices are believed to have ticked up 0.2% from September to October, the same as in the previous month. Excluding volatile food and energy costs, so-called core prices are forecast to have risen 3.3% from a year earlier, unchanged from the previous month.

Sri Lankan president seeks party win in parliamentary election to help him push his economic reforms

Sri Lankan President Anura Kumara Dissanayake is looking to consolidate his party's power in Thursday's parliamentary election to help him implement his election pledges to solve the country's economic woes and foster good governance. The Marxist-leaning Dissanayake won the presidential election on Sept. 21 in a victory that marked a rejection of the traditional political parties that have governed the island nation since its independence from British rule in 1948.
